Online & Distance Learning at Shepherd University

Online coursework is an option at Shepherd University. Of 3,339 students, 461 (14%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 1,673 (50%) took at least some classes online.

Earnings for Business Administration & Management Graduates from Shepherd University

Those who finish Shepherd University’s Business Administration & Management program earn the following amounts (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):

Median earnings by years after graduation for Business Administration & Management at Shepherd University
Years After Graduation Median Earnings
1 year $43,479
2 years $38,237
3 years $43,769
4 years $53,391
5 years $53,057

Is this above or below average for the school? Four years after graduating, Business Administration & Management graduates from Shepherd University report median earnings of $53,391, compared with $51,887 for all Shepherd University graduates — about 3% higher than the school-wide median.

Median Debt at Graduation

Median student loan debt for Business Administration & Management graduates from Shepherd University stands at $18,500.
